⦿⦿ElectriX Podcast⦿⦿ Welcome back to a new episode of ElectriX. I hope all of you are well and you had a great week. I have a new podcast ready for you on demand. This week I invited berlin based Dj TJQ to the show. He prepared a great Dj set full of variety and changes. One to enjoy a lot. Hope you will have fun with this one. Like the Mix? Click the [Repost] 🔁 button so more people can hear it! —————————————————————————————— Bio: A passionate curator of electronic sounds, TJQ channels passion directly into the decks, believing that the music should speak louder than words. Disdainful of self-promotion, he rejects the idea that a well-crafted bio defines success, preferring to let his sets and selections define their legacy. ——————————————————————————————— Tracklist: 1.
